the claim
Surface ocean current velocity changes with depth along a velocity gradient

Multiple observational and theoretical studies confirm that surface ocean and water current velocity varies with depth along a distinct velocity gradient due to wind forcing, surface waves, and bottom friction.

The analysis

The claim asserts that surface ocean current velocity changes with depth along a velocity gradient. Retrieved papers explicitly document vertical velocity profiles and velocity shear across the water column in both oceanic and riverine settings, supporting the claim without contradiction.
